The anatomy of the limbus and its relationship to the fossa ovalis were studied in 90 normal human hearts in an attempt to explain the clinical success of blunt trans-septal catheterization. Previously reported rates of patent foramen ovale (25-35% of adult specimens) were confirmed, well below the reported rate of success for blunt trans-septal catheterization (67-87%). A possible reason for this success is the fragile attachment of the fossa ovalis to its limbus in nearly all hearts without persistent patency.
